Mechanical and Tribological Properties of Ta-N and Ta-Al-N Coatings Deposited by Reactive High Power Impulse Magnetron Sputtering

Valentina Zin et al.

Summary: This article describes the depositions and functional characterizations of Ta-N and Ta-Al-N coatings grown by reactive high-power impulse magnetron sputtering onto silicon substrates for protection purposes. The effects of changing substrate polarization voltage and adding Al to form a ternary system on the mechanical and tribological properties of the coatings have been investigated. Micro-Raman characterization reveals different wear mechanisms between Ta-N and Ta-Al-N films, with Ta-N coatings undergoing plastic deformation and Ta-Al-N films suffering higher oxidation phenomena.

Structure, Mechanical, and Micro-Scratch Behavior of Ta-Hf-C Solid Solution Coating Deposited by Non-Reactive Magnetron Sputtering

Zhenyu Tan et al.

Summary: The TaC, HfC, and Hf-Ta-C coatings were successfully prepared using non-reactively DC magnetron sputtering. The effects of working pressure and deposition temperature on the structure and mechanical properties of Ta-Hf-C coating were analyzed. The scratch performance of the Ta-Hf-C coating on different substrates was investigated. The results showed that the Ta-Hf-C coating exhibited enhanced hardness and elastic modulus, making it a promising protective coating for cutting tools.
